Arlington, TX

Tarrant County

Some Restrictions

Arlington's short-term rental ordinance requires that all guest vehicles park on-site in the driveway or dedicated parking pad, with a cap tied to bedroom count. Street parking is discouraged and specifically prohibited for STR guests in many neighborhoods around AT&T Stadium and Globe Life Field where event-day parking is already contested. Overnight parking on unpaved surfaces is prohibited citywide.

North Richland Hills, TX

Tarrant County

Some Restrictions

Short-term rentals operating under a specific use permit in North Richland Hills must provide adequate off-street guest parking without overflow onto neighborhood streets. Typical SUP conditions require two off-street spaces plus one additional space per bedroom over two, and front-lawn parking is prohibited.

Arlington FAQ

Can my Airbnb guests park on the street in Arlington?

Generally yes on public streets, but not during posted event tow zones and not where an HOA prohibits overnight on-street parking.

Can I let guests park on the lawn for a Cowboys game?

No. Parking on unpaved surfaces is prohibited citywide and will draw a citation.

North Richland Hills FAQ

How many cars can STR guests park at an NRH rental?

Typical SUP terms require all guest vehicles to park off-street, usually two driveway spaces plus one per bedroom over two. Lawn parking and blocked driveways are always prohibited.

Can STR guests park on the street?

On public residential streets generally yes within the general parking rules. HOA private streets may prohibit all on-street parking, and commercial and RV vehicles have tighter limits.
